  1. Lascar Types and Lascar Automorphisms in Abstract Elementary Classes.Tapani Hyttinen & Meeri Kesälä - 2011 - Notre Dame Journal of Formal Logic 52 (1):39-54.
    We study Lascar strong types and Galois types and especially their relation to notions of type which have finite character. We define a notion of a strong type with finite character, the so-called Lascar type. We show that this notion is stronger than Galois type over countable sets in simple and superstable finitary AECs. Furthermore, we give an example where the Galois type itself does not have finite character in such a class.

    Lascar strong types in some simple theories.Steven Buechler - 1999 - Journal of Symbolic Logic 64 (2):817-824.
    In this paper a class of simple theories, called the low theories is developed, and the following is proved. Theorem. Let T be a low theory. A set and a, b elements realizing the same strong type over A. Then, a and b realized the same Lascar strong type over A.

    A note on Lascar strong types in simple theories.Byunghan Kim - 1998 - Journal of Symbolic Logic 63 (3):926-936.
    Let T be a countable, small simple theory. In this paper, we prove that for such T, the notion of Lascar strong type coincides with the notion of strong type, over an arbitrary set.

    Classifying spaces and the Lascar group.Tim Campion, Greg Cousins & Jinhe Ye - 2021 - Journal of Symbolic Logic 86 (4):1396-1431.
    We show that the Lascar group $\operatorname {Gal}_L$ of a first-order theory T is naturally isomorphic to the fundamental group $\pi _1|)$ of the classifying space of the category of models of T and elementary embeddings. We use this identification to compute the Lascar groups of several example theories via homotopy-theoretic methods, and in fact completely characterize the homotopy type of $|\mathrm {Mod}|$ for these theories T.     Galois groups of first order theories.E. Casanovas, D. Lascar, A. Pillay & M. Ziegler - 2001 - Journal of Mathematical Logic 1 (02):305-319.
    We study the groups Gal L and Gal KP, and the associated equivalence relations EL and EKP, attached to a first order theory T. An example is given where EL≠ EKP. It is proved that EKP is the composition of EL and the closure of EL. Other examples are given showing this is best possible.
